Abstract

The objective of this work was to develop a method to identify and monitor, in near real‑time, crop field areas cultivated with temporary summer crops, using Modis orbital images, in the state of Rio Grande do Sul, Brazil. The methodology was called near real‑time detection of crop fields (DATQuaR) and uses Modis sensor images of the NDVI and EVI vegetation indices (VIs) from 16‑day composites. Four different metrics were used to aggregate the values of VIs per pixel, in the bimonthly periods evaluated: average, maximum, minimum, and median. To generate the images (ImDATQuaR), the aggregated image for the previous period was subtracted from the aggregated image for the monitored period. These images were classified by slicing and compared with the reference classes obtained by the visual interpretation of randomly selected pixels in Landsat images. Each ImDATQuaR image generated two DATQuaR maps: one with a 3x3 pixel window mode filter and another without filtering. The best DATQuaR map is produced using EVI images and filtering – by subtracting the image of minimum value for the previous period from the image of maximum value for the monitored period – and achieves agreement with the reference over 81%.
